Abstract
Olive oil was almost completely hydrolyzed by lipase in reverse micelles. R value and initial water content were found to be the most important factors that determine the hydrolyzing rate and degree of hydrolysis, respectively. The hydrolysis rate and the stability of the enzyme were affected by stirring and addition of histidine or glycerol.
